Expanded polystyrene, often referred to as EPS, is a lightweight, rigid plastic material made from polystyrene beads This versatile material is commonly used in a wide range of applications, from packaging to construction One important characteristic to consider when working with EPS is its density, typically measured in kilograms per cubic meter (kg/m3) In this article, we will explore the significance of EPS with a density of 100 kg/m3, known as EPS 100 kg m3.
EPS with a density of 100 kg/m3 is a popular choice in various industries due to its optimal balance of strength and weight The density of EPS is a crucial factor in determining its mechanical properties and performance characteristics A higher density EPS will have greater strength and durability, while lower density EPS will be lighter and more flexible.
EPS 100 kg/m3 strikes a balance between strength and weight, making it suitable for a wide range of applications This density is often used in packaging materials, insulation boards, and lightweight fillers EPS 100 kg/m3 offers excellent thermal insulation properties, making it an ideal choice for construction projects where energy efficiency is a priority.
One of the key advantages of EPS 100 kg/m3 is its lightweight nature Despite its low weight, EPS 100 kg/m3 is exceptionally strong and durable, making it an ideal material for packaging and cushioning applications Its lightweight properties also make it easy to handle and transport, reducing shipping costs and environmental impact.
Another important characteristic of EPS 100 kg/m3 is its moisture resistance EPS is inherently water-resistant, making it an ideal choice for applications where exposure to moisture is a concern EPS 100 kg/m3 retains its shape and structural integrity even when exposed to moisture, making it a durable and reliable material for outdoor use.
